Ski Report for Steamboat, Colorado
Daily Ski Conditions for Steamboat, Colorado
Steamboat Springs, Colorado, is buzzing with excitement for skiers and snowboarders alike as spring brings a delightful mix of snow and sunshine to the slopes. As of April 11, 2025, the snow conditions are looking fantastic, promising a thrilling experience for all winter enthusiasts.
Currently, the snow depth measures a robust 51 inches at the base and a staggering 107 inches at the summit, ensuring that the powder is plentiful for those looking to carve their way through the mountain's majestic terrain. In the last 24 hours, Steamboat has received a light refresh of 2.5 inches at mid-mountain and 4 inches at the summit, which has contributed to a soft, inviting surface for riding. Over the past 48 hours, the total snowfall has added a nice cushion to the established base, enhancing both piste and off-piste conditions.
With 16 lifts open and a staggering 170 trails accessible—a total of 3,022 acres ready for exploring—there's no shortage of options. Whether you're a beginner looking to take your first turns or an expert seeking out hidden gems, Steamboat's diverse terrain has something for everyone. The snow is reported as packed powder, mixed with spring conditions, which means you'll experience that delightful combination of firm yet forgiving snow that makes for thrilling descents.
Today's weather is generally pleasant, with a base temperature around 38°F and summits a cooler 28°F, making it perfect for a day on the snow without the chill. Expect partly cloudy skies overhead, with a breeze from the east-northeast at about 10 to 15 mph. This kind of weather is ideal for enjoying the breathtaking views that Steamboat has to offer while hitting the slopes.
As we look toward the future, the weather forecast for the next five days suggests mostly clear skies with temperatures rising, peaking around 70°F this weekend. While there’s no significant snowfall expected in the immediate forecast, the beautiful spring days mean you can enjoy the mountain warmth and the thrill of skiing or snowboarding.
Steamboat has recorded a seasonal total snowfall of 110 inches so far this season, with notable powder days back in February, prompting some jaw-dropping conditions. Experienced skiers and boarders will appreciate the current off-piste conditions, but caution is advised due to potential avalanche risks in some areas. Be aware of wind-drifted slabs, particularly on steeper slopes, and stick to safer terrain unless you're equipped and experienced enough to navigate the more challenging zones.
